Also affected by this bug, I also have a logitec Quickcam connected to the system.
It appears when I switch from one user session to another, sometimes the system seems to be freeze, but when I switch t the console (Alt+F1) I witness it's steel working, and the message "Cannot set from 16000..." is printed every second
